Abstract
This paper offers a critique of manufacturing performance measurement approaches investigated by previous studies particularly in trade-off modelling studies for manufacturing capabilities. We argue that some studies complete validity analyses of the trade-off model using measures of manufacturing performance that are inconsistent with the trade-off theoretical concept. The paper also seeks to synthesize the relationship between the cumulative capabilities model and the trade-off model within the context of the performance frontiers theory. The results of this analysis seek to advance theory development in this arena, yielding specific and novel research topics and proposals for future studies
